Vinyl siding hole repair services involve fixing small to large holes that appear in the exterior siding of a property. Over time, damage from impacts, harsh weather, or general wear and tear can cause these openings, which compromise the appearance and protective barrier of the siding. Skilled contractors assess the size and location of the holes, then carefully patch or replace the affected sections to restore the siding’s integrity. This process helps ensure that the exterior remains weather-resistant and visually appealing, preventing further damage and potential issues like moisture intrusion.

This service addresses common problems such as cracks, punctures, or holes caused by hail, falling debris, or accidental impacts. When these issues are left unaddressed, they can lead to more serious complications, including water leaks, mold growth, or structural deterioration. Vinyl siding hole repair provides a practical solution to maintain the property’s durability and curb appeal. It is especially useful for homeowners noticing visible damage or experiencing drafts and moisture infiltration around affected areas.

The overview below groups typical Vinyl Siding Hole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hilliard,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or vinyl siding hole repairs range from $250 to $600 for many routine jobs. Most local contractors handle these quickly and efficiently within this range, depending on the size and location of the damage.

Moderate Fixes - More noticeable or slightly larger holes generally c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common and often involve replacing a few panels or sections to restore appearance and protection.

Large Patches or Multiple Repairs - Extensive damage or multiple holes can push costs into the $1,200 to $2,500 range. Fewer projects reach this tier, but they typically involve significant patchwork or repairs across multiple areas.

Full Vinyl Siding Replacement - When damage is widespread, full replacement of affected siding sections may range from $3,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this, but most repairs fall within typical mid-range cost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es holes in vinyl siding? Holes in vinyl siding can result from impacts such as hail, lawn equipment, or accidental collisions, as well as from weather-related damage or age-related wear and tear.

How do local contractors repair holes in vinyl siding? Contractors typically assess the damage, remove the affected section, and replace it with a matching piece to ensure a seamless repair that maintains the siding’s appearance.

Can small holes be fixed without replacing large sections? Yes, small holes can often be patched using specialized repair kits or sealants, but larger or multiple holes may require replacing entire panels for a durable fix.

Is it necessary to repaint vinyl siding after hole repair? Generally, repainting isn’t needed if the repair matches the existing color and finish, but some contractors may recommend touch-up painting for a uniform look.
